Output d0465462bcfa9f13c4c8f1b1f4621d1cc7e4267f9e12e3f244f8fe6e5bf763a8:115

value
31953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ef66d8e3b8784b58db0bb02de88a17d7afb76d4 OP_EQUAL
address
3348bLtCp6pVdc2S7VzVGVjHwVdkvREiB4
transaction
d0465462bcfa9f13c4c8f1b1f4621d1cc7e4267f9e12e3f244f8fe6e5bf763a8
confirmations
165791
spent
true